Lines Matching refs:layout
7 layout::ArrayLayout,
110 layout: ArrayLayout<T>, field
185 self.layout.len() in capacity()
293 layout: ArrayLayout::empty(), in new()
551 let layout = if Self::is_zst() { in from_raw_parts() localVariable
565 layout, in from_raw_parts()
638 let layout = ArrayLayout::new(new_cap).map_err(|_| AllocError)?; in reserve() localVariable
647 layout.into(), in reserve()
648 self.layout.into(), in reserve()
658 self.layout = layout; in reserve()
847 unsafe { A::free(self.ptr.cast(), self.layout.into()) }; in drop()
1061 let size = self.layout.size(); in page_iter()
1088 layout: ArrayLayout<T>, field
1101 let cap = me.layout.len(); in into_raw_parts()
1141 let old_layout = self.layout; in collect()
1159 let layout = unsafe { ArrayLayout::<T>::new_unchecked(len) }; in collect() localVariable
1167 layout.into(), in collect()
1264 unsafe { A::free(self.buf.cast(), self.layout.into()) }; in drop()
1306 let layout = self.layout; in into_iter() localVariable
1313 layout, in into_iter()